Basically, CGH-SDU provides the most frequent flights and usually the cheapest. Other posters indicate it is no problem buying the ticket the day of travel.
I understand TAM runs a bus service between GRU and CGH. A search of either TAM or GOL websites should give you the earliest flight scheduled.

Interesting, because last month when I tried to book on www.webjet.com.br it had the facility to use a foreign-issued Amex card but would not process the purchase without a CPF. I went to the online help facility and the agent said that there was no way for a non-Brasilian resident (without a CPF) to make a purchase online. Were you able to buy without a CPF? I used to be able to do this on the OceanAir website but they now require a CPF too.
As to purchasing from TAM international sites, the issue I have found is that they never have the deep discount promotional fares on any but their local Brasilian site, whereas the Gol Argentinian and other International sites have always had their lowest fares available for purchase in my experience.
If you can't purchase online you have to add a R30 fee for ticketing at the airport and if your travel is Dec 28 I wouldn't count on cheap fares being available for purchase at the airport just prior to departure.

Thanks, how the hell do I get a CPF though?? Wonder if the owner of the pousada in Rio that I'm staying at will help?
There are several ways you could handle the issue:
1) you may buy your ticket over the counter at the airport after arriving;
2) you may buy the ticket through a travel agent or by
Webjet call center (0300 21 01234), or by email saying you have a foreing issued CC e-mail falecom@webjet.com.br
3) finally, just try to fill in any number in the CPF space like 00000. I think the reservation system will accept once they recognise you have a foreign issued CC.
You may also ask your pousada do buy your ticket for you.
Note that the only accepted foreign issued CC is AmEx.
